Foundation stabilizing services involve methods to reinforce and support the structural integrity of a building’s foundation. These services typically include techniques such as pier installation, mudjacking, underpinning, and soil stabilization, which work to address issues caused by shifting or settling soil. The goal is to restore stability, prevent further movement, and ensure the foundation can support the weight of the structure safely. Professionals use specialized equipment and materials to assess the condition of the foundation and implement the most appropriate stabilization solutions for each property.

These services are essential for resolving problems related to foundation movement, such as cracks in walls or floors, uneven flooring, sticking doors or windows, and visible settling or sinking. When a foundation shifts or settles unevenly, it can cause structural stress that may lead to more serious issues if left unaddressed. Foundation stabilizing helps mitigate these risks by providing a firm and level base for the building, reducing the likelihood of further damage and costly repairs over time.

Foundation Stabilizing Costs - Typical expenses for foundation stabilization services range from $3,000 to $15,000, depending on the extent of the work needed. For example, a small residential repair may cost around $3,500, while larger projects can exceed $12,000.

Material and Equipment Fees - Material costs, such as steel piers or mudjacking foam, usually account for $1,000 to $5,000 of the total. Equipment rental or specialized tools may add an additional $500 to $2,000 to the overall cost.

Labor and Service Charges - Labor fees for foundation stabilization services typically range from $50 to $150 per hour. Total labor costs depend on project size, with small repairs averaging around $2,000 and larger jobs reaching $10,000 or more.

Additional Expenses - Extra costs may include site preparation, inspection, or permits, which can add $500 to $2,000 to the project total. Variations in local rates and project complexity influence the final price range.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are foundation stabilizing services? Foundation stabilizing services involve techniques to reinforce and support a building's foundation to prevent or repair settlement issues and structural movement.

How do foundation stabilization methods work? These methods typically include installing piers, underpinning, or braces to lift and secure the foundation, addressing underlying soil issues and improving stability.

When is foundation stabilization necessary? Stabilization may be needed if signs like uneven flooring, cracked walls, or doors that don’t close properly appear, indicating potential foundation movement or damage.

What types of foundation stabilization techniques are available? Common techniques include pier and beam installation, slab underpinning, and soil injection, each suited to different foundation types and issues.
